Steve "Pokey" Trachsel helped pitch Duluth to the Little League World Series in 1963 before starring in hockey at Duluth Cathedral High School and for the Minnesota Duluth Bulldogs.Randolph was a year younger than Hilltoppers’ phenom Steve “Pokey” Trachsel, a defenseman who as a senior drew comparisons to Warroad’s Henry Boucha, and three years younger than Cathedral forward Phil Hoene, a lightning-fast skater who was a magician with the puck.
